Role Description

RIVA Solutions is seeking an experienced Senior Drupal Developer to serve as a technical leader on a large-scale enterprise Drupal platform supporting a federal program.

  • Design, build, and maintain enterprise Drupal CMS architecture.
  • Develop and maintain custom Drupal modules and reusable components.
  • Lead system integrations between Drupal and external systems via APIs and web services.
  • Architect scalable solutions aligned with federal digital standards.
  • Conduct peer code reviews and establish development best practices.
  • Ensure compliance with Section 508 accessibility standards.
  • Oversee security updates, patch management, and vulnerability remediation.
  • Collaborate with DevSecOps teams to support CI/CD pipelines and deployment workflows.
  • Optimize performance, caching, and scalability strategies.
  • Provide technical mentorship to junior and mid-level developers.
  • Participate in backlog refinement and technical planning sessions.
  • Maintain documentation for architecture, integrations, and deployment processes.
  • Support platform modernization initiatives and technical debt reduction efforts.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or related field.
  • Minimum 6+ years of professional experience developing websites in Drupal.
  • Demonstrated experience designing and maintaining enterprise Drupal CMS architecture.
  • Experience building and maintaining custom Drupal modules.
  • Experience implementing and maintaining system integrations using RESTful APIs and web services.
  • Strong knowledge of Drupal security best practices and patch management.
  • Experience ensuring and validating Section 508 accessibility compliance.
  • Experience conducting peer code reviews and mentoring development teams.
  • Strong understanding of version control systems (Git) and modern development workflows.
  • Experience supporting federal or regulated digital environments.
  • U.S. Citizenship with the ability to obtain and maintain a Federal Security Clearance.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ience supporting enterprise-scale federal web modernization initiatives.
  • Experience with Drupal 9/10 and migration from legacy versions.
  • Familiarity with containerization and cloud-based hosting environments.
  • Experience working within Agile delivery environments.
  • Experience integrating Drupal with CRM, identity management, or enterprise service systems.
  • Acquia or other Drupal certifications.
  • Familiarity with automated accessibility testing tools.
